This elegant vintage Montre Royale Genève dress watch from the late 1960s/early 1970s combines timeless design with fine Swiss craftsmanship. The solid 18K yellow gold rectangular case (32.5 x 40 mm) houses a vertically brushed champagne dial with applied gold hour markers and matching hands, creating a minimalist aesthetic that remains sophisticated today.
Powered by a Swiss-made manual winding movement from Frédérique Piguet with 17 jewels, it runs smoothly and shares heritage with prestigious brands like Rolex Cellini and Patek Philippe. The case interior features authentic Swiss hallmarks, including the Helvetia head and 0.750 stamp, confirming its genuine 18K gold construction.
